Frédéric Guieu Baritone
Chorus of the Opera

© Adrien Poupin

Biography

Member of the Paris Opera Chorus

Born in Milan, Frédéric Guieu began his musical studies with piano. He earned a CAPES in musicology from the Sorbonne and studied vocal art with Gina Gigna and Ugo Ugaro.

He has performed a wide range of roles, including Golaud in Pelléas et Mélisande, Belcore in L'Elisir d'Amore, and the title role in Don Giovanni. He joined the Paris Opera Chorus in 2003.

At the Paris Opera: Don Pasquale (un notaro), 2018, 2019
